Movement of all vehicles will be restricted on Kutaisi bypass and Kutaisi-Samtredia roads
26 November, 2016 00:00:00

According to Roads Department of the Ministry of Regional Development and Infrastructure of Georgia, works are underway (repairing works of expansion joints and bridge crossing compensators) on Kutaisi bypass road section of Tbilisi-Senaki-Leselidze international road until 29 November 2016, 8:00 a.m. Therefore, movement of all vehicles is restricted on Kutaisi bypass road starting from km 216 (Nakhshirgele village) of Tbilisi-Senaki-Leselidze road. Traffic flow will be diverted to Tbilisi-Senaki-Leselidze road (old direction) passing through Kutaisi City.  

Traffic restriction on the mentioned road section will be carried out according to temporal traffic flow organization schemes agreed with the Patrol Police on 29 October, 2015 ((№20/8-2392244).

Within the framework of construction project of Zestaponi-Kutaisi-Samtredia road section of Tbilisi-Senaki-Leselidze international road, regarding the continuation of planned, ongoing works, movement of all vehicles is restricted starting from km 247 (Bashi) of Kutaisi bypass-Samtredia road to km2 of Samtredia-Lanchkhuti-Grigoleti (Dapnari ramp) of Tbilisi-Senaki-Leselidze road, including December 5. Traffic flow will be diverted to Tbilisi-Senaki-Leselidze (old) existing road, towards Samtredia.

Traffic restriction on the mentioned road section will be carried out according to temporal traffic flow organization schemes agreed with the Patrol Police on 27 October, 2016 (№2693860).
